Report: Azzi Fudd to avoid fine for remarks about refs
May 3, 2026; Austin, TX, USA; Dallas Wings guards Azzi Fudd (35) and Paige Bueckers (5) at the start of the second half against the Las Vegas Aces at Moody Center. Mandatory Credit: Scott Wachter-Imagn Images No. 1 overall draft pick Azzi Fudd reportedly will not be fined for complaining about the officiating on Sunday.
Front Office Sports said the Dallas Wings rookie guard will avoid punishment for her remarks following the preseason win against the Las Vegas Aces.
"Honestly, I'm more confused," the former UConn star said when asked about her adjustment to the more physical WNBA. "I thought you could be physical in the W and anytime you touch someone, it's a foul. So I'm not really sure whether to be physical, whether to -- I don't know. I'm still figuring that out."
Fudd finished the Wings' 101-84 victory in Austin, Texas, with 12 points, one assist and two fouls in 21 minutes as a starter.
Dallas will open the 2026 WNBA regular season on Saturday against Caitlin Clark and the host Indiana Fever.
